Why is cleaning solar PV panels important? Many environmental factors such as pollution or vehicular movement result in dust generation and soiling over the solar panel, leading to reduction in the efficiency and energy output of the panels.

During nighttime or on cloudy days, solar panels cannot directly generate electricity. This makes it necessary to find alternative solutions to ensure a continuous supply of power, especially during periods of high energy demand.
